Output 32095a21b12306386d0b9ef78f4b39db56aab51bf574e3567e829d0fe48541b5:20

value
12755913
script pubkey
OP_0 OP_PUSHBYTES_20 1445b8e68d2d400c27b76008745fc2fcb35b6ea8
address
ltc1qz3zm3e5d94qqcfahvqy8gh7zlje4km4gr3j3kk
transaction
32095a21b12306386d0b9ef78f4b39db56aab51bf574e3567e829d0fe48541b5
spent
true